Output 52251ec0ceaacaf17518b62e0b5dd1644ef87dc132ea52da230b41d7a4640a30:3

value
2697236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 485b902ffa43681d4ad364496f1d50290e236530 OP_EQUALVERIFY OP_CHECKSIG
address
17bbLjjDWLidBtgyDvz6NUgAdTgTBYbVVs
transaction
52251ec0ceaacaf17518b62e0b5dd1644ef87dc132ea52da230b41d7a4640a30
spent
true